Color Psychology And Color Therapy: A Factual Study Of The Influence Of Color On Human Life is a comprehensive book written by Faber Birren that explores the impact of color on human emotions, behavior, and overall well-being. The book delves into the psychological and physiological effects of color on individuals and provides a detailed analysis of how different colors can affect mood and perception.The book is divided into two parts, with the first part focusing on color psychology and the second part on color therapy. In the first part, Birren examines the different theories and research regarding the psychological effects of color, including the impact of color on memory, attention, and perception. He also explores the cultural and historical significance of color and how it has been used in art, architecture, and design.In the second part, Birren discusses the use of color therapy as a complementary treatment for various health conditions, including anxiety, depression, and stress. He provides a detailed analysis of the different color therapies, including chromotherapy, colorpuncture, and color breathing, and how they can be used to promote healing and well-being.Overall, Color Psychology And Color Therapy: A Factual Study Of The Influence Of Color On Human Life is an informative and engaging book that provides a comprehensive overview of the impact of color on human life. It is suitable for anyone interested in the psychology of color, as well as those seeking alternative therapies for various health conditions.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
